The Bolingbrook Raiders will challenge the Joliet Central Steelmen at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Bolingbrook will be strutting in after a victory while Joliet Central will be coming in after a loss.
Bolingbrook's offense will try to repeat the strong performance it gave on Friday, when they got past Oswego East's usually-dominant defense. The Raiders put the hurt on the Wolves with a sharp 32-7 win. The result was nothing new for the Raiders, who have now won three contests by 22 points or more so far this season.
Meanwhile, Joliet Central was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fourth straight defeat. They came up short against Plainfield Central, falling 35-10. The Steelmen were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 21-0.
Joliet Central's loss dropped their record down to 1-4. As for Bolingbrook, they now have a winning record of 3-2.
Everything came up roses for Bolingbrook against Joliet Central when the teams last played back in October of 2015, as the team secured a 68-6 victory. Will the Raiders repeat their success, or do the Steelmen have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
